In Arborville, California, three high school students try to protect their hometown from a gelatinous alien life form that engulfs everything it touches. The first to discover the substance and live to tell about it, the trio witness the Blob destroying an elderly man, then it growing to a terrifying size. But no one else has seen the goo, and the police refuse to believe the kids without proof.

Made on a bigger budget with better special effects, this 'Blob' remake from 'A Nightmare on Elm Street 3: Dream Warriors' director Chuck Russell and 'The Mist' screenwriter Frank Darabont is a far creepier experience than the original ever was. Memorable, unsettling moments include an arm being ripped off a teenager that the blob is consuming and the shock reveal of a literally half-eaten corpse on a hospital bed. What truly distinguishes the 1988 version from the 1958 take though are the scattered intelligent attempts to explain the presence of the blob and how it landed in the town. At one point, it is likened to a 'plague', possibly part of the asteroid that is said to have wiped out the dinosaurs; at another point, it is speculated that it is military biological warfare with Cold War tensions hinted at. The remake does little to improve on the characters and the performances though. The notion of a town imbued with cynical adults unwilling to believe any teenagers or kids is sadly missing here and the most likable teen character is killed off very early on. Never to mind, the film is entertaining until the end with lots of well-placed humour (condon-buying shenanigans; horror movie cinema audience reaction shots edited against various blob attacks; a cutaway to red jelly being slurped) and while all the carnage during the final few scenes grows a little recycled and tiresome, the sheer terror of the blob is felt throughout. The ending also leaves open room for a sequel that never eventuated, though a further remake for the 2010s is apparently in the works.
